  • Fans need to be realistic in summer

    Whether we have a 5p or £15m budget this squad needs total rebuilding and that will involve buying a few quality players (hopefully) but also some fillers. Lots of moaning about Clint Hill. I am expecting a fair few like him, players that can do a job at this level without setting the world on fire.

    We have seriously lacked depth in the squad as well as the more obvious things like a striker who can consistently kick the round thing between the stick things.

    I for one will be happy if we sort out full backs, extra centre back or two, goalkeeper and a couple of decent strikers. I am confident with NW we will end up with a far better team next season and one which will not buckle under stress.

    People have questioned what he has done at Palarse. Well look at their situation. If you add on their 10 points about the same as us but with the threat of extinction hanging over them and with a far less gifted squad. They have frequently upped their game this season. Have we? By rights they should have been down and out even without the 10 point deduction.

    I'm excited about next season too Colin!
